

Mark Alan Shipman passed away on Monday, October 5, 2009. Mark was born in Crete, Nebraska on February 21, 1951 to Robert H. and JoAnn Shipman. His family moved to Marysville, Kansas early in Mark’s childhood. After growing up in Marysville, Mark adventured to the big city to attend college at UMKC where he graduated, majoring in Speech and Journalism. Mark’s “gift for gab” made him a popular figure in the restaurant industry, specifically, behind the bar. As a bartender for over 25 years, Mark never met a customer he didn’t listen to, or talk to, about anything and everything. Mark loved most being with his family; fishing, cooking, cycling; and talking about any kind of sports. During the past 20 years, his passion was talking about his three children, and every one of their triumphs and tribulations.Mark is preceded in death by his mother, JoAnn Shipman. Mark leaves behind his wife of 20 years, Joyce M. Shipman; three extraordinary children, Anna, Jeff, and John, all of the home; his father, Robert H. Shipman, Marysville, KS; his brother, Robert H. Shipman, Jr., Stillwell, KS; numerous brothers and sisters-in-law; as well as many nieces, nephews and great -nieces and nephews, and cousins.
